计算机专业高级教程期中考试(数据库)_第1页
计算机专业高级教程期中考试(数据库)_第2页
计算机专业高级教程期中考试(数据库)_第3页
计算机专业高级教程期中考试(数据库)_第4页
已阅读5页,还剩3页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、学习必备欢迎下载中职计算机专业高级教程期中考试(数据库)班级姓名成绩一、单选题(每题1 分,共 20 分)1.有关数据库的特点,以下叙述错误的是()A. 可以供各种用户共享B.冗余度小C. 较高的数据独立性D.数据由应用程序自己控制2.数据库类型是按照 _ _来划分的()。A. 文件形式B.数据模型C.记录形式D.数据存取方法3.下列关于数据库说法错误的是()。A. 关系型数据库采用二维表为基本数据结构B. RDBS是非关系型数据库C. 数据库中的数据是按一定的数据模型组织的D. 非关系型数据库系统以记录型为基本数据结构4.在以下数据库管理系统中,开放源代码的是()。A. AccessB. S

2、QL ServerC. MySQLD. Oracle5.在二维表中,每一行称为()A. 一条记录B.一个字段C.一条信息D.一个关系6.在二维表中,每一列称为()A. 一条记录B.一个字段C.一条信息D.一个关系7.在设计数据表时,“姓名”字段一般应设置为属性()。A. 字符型B.数值型C.日期型D.逻辑型8.以下关于关系型数据库中二维表性质的说法不正确的是()。A. 二维表中的每一列均有唯一的字段名。B. 二维表中的记录数、字段数决定了二维表的结构。C. 二维表中的行、列均可以改变。D. 二维表中不允许出现完全相同的两行。9. 在数据库中,下列关于数据表叙述错误的是()。A. 数据表是实际存

3、放数据的地方。B. 每张数据表中应该包含重复的数据。C. 每张表只包含一个主题信息。D. 设计数据表时,最重要的是规划好字段的类型。10. 数据库系统中,数据的最小访问单位是()。A. 记录B.字段C.字节D.表11. 下列关于 SQL说法正确的是()A. SQL 是过程化语言B. SQL只有一种使用环境C. SQL命令多而功能丰富D.所有用 SQL编写的语句都是可以移植的学习必备欢迎下载12. SQL中 SELECT语句的中文含义是 ()A. 建数据表B.添加数据C.打印数据D.查询数据13. 如某 SELECT命令中同时有 FROM、WHERE、ORDER三个子句,则正确的排列顺序是()A

4、. FROM、 WHERE、ORDERB. FROM、ORDER、WHEREC. WHERE、ORDER、FROMD.没有顺序要求,无论哪个子句排在前均可14. 执行语句“ SELECT 姓名,语文,数学,英文,语文 +数学 +英语 AS总分 FROM学生成绩”后,以下说法正确的是()。A. 在“学生成绩”数据表中添加一个新的字段“总分”。B. 在“学生成绩”数据表中添加一个新的字段“总分”,并在屏幕上显示该字段的值。C. 能在屏幕上显示总分指端,数据表“学生成绩”中并不新增字段。D. 以上说法都不对。15. 查询姓“张”同学的记录时,使用的WHERE子句应该是()。A. 姓名 =“张 * ”

5、B.姓名 =“张”C. 姓名 LIKE“张 * ”D.姓名 LIKE “张”16. 假设“是否团员”为逻辑字段,则显示“学生”数据表中所有“团员”记录的SQL语句是()。A. SELECT * FROM 学生 WHERE是否团员 =“团员”B. SELECT * FROM 学生 WHERE是否团员 =团员C. SELECT * FROM 学生 WHERE是否团员 =.T.D. SELECT * FROM 学生 WHERE是否团员17. 显示“学生档案”数据表中出生日期为1990 年 6 月 1 日的记录的命令是()。A. SELECT * FROM 学生档案B. SELECT * FROM 学

6、生档案C. SELECT * FROM 学生档案D. 以上命令均正确WHERE出生日期 =#6/1/1990#WHERE出生日期 =“6/1/1990 ”WHERE出生日期 =6/1/99018. 某“学生”数据表中共有 50 条记录, 5 个字段,命令“ SELECTCOUNT(*)FROM学生”将产生条输出结果()。A.1B.5C.50D.5119. 关于 SELECT中 ORDER子句的说法,以下正确的是()。A. 参数 ASC表示递增, DESC表示递减,默认为递增B. 参数 ASC表示递增, DESC表示递减,默认为递减C. 参数 ASC表示递减, DESC表示递增,默认为递增D.

7、参数 ASC表示递减, DESC表示递增,默认为递减20. 在 SQL查询中, GROUP BY语句用于()。A. 选择行条件B.对查询进行排序C.列表D.分组条件二、填空题(每空1 分,共 20 分)学习必备欢迎下载1.数据库管理系统 DBMS是位于用户与之间的一层数据管理软件。2.数据库管理系统主要功能包括数据定义、数据库的控制、数据库的维护。3.数据库与文件系统的本质区别是。4.数据库技术的核心是。5.在数据库技术中,主要的数据模型有:层次模型、网状模型和。6.用二维表的形式来表示实体间联系的数据模型叫做。7.关系型数据库采用二维表为基本数据结构,通过实现不同二维表之间的联系。8. 写出

8、以下字段应该选择的字段类型。姓名、成绩、身高、电话号码。9.数据表中字段最常用的有、和四种字段类型。10.SQL中文全称为。11.SQL的有点有极少的命令、及。12.在 ORDER BY子句的参数选项中,代表降序输出。代表升序输出。三、是非题(正确打“” ,错误打“”。每题 1 分,共 10 分)( ) 1. 数据库是位于用户和操作系统之间的一层数据软件,它由系统运行控制程序、语言翻译程序和一组公用程序组成。()2.20 世纪60 年代末期,美国Microsoft公司开发了第一个商品化的数据库系统 IMS 系统( Information Management System)。( ) 3. 在数

9、据库技术发展过程中,主要经历了三种模型:层次模型、网状模型和关系模型。( )4.MySQL是一个小型关系型数据库管理系统, 具有开放源代码方式特点,属于 Oracle 公司所有。()5. 数据库中实际存放数据的地方是表。()6. 每张数据表中应只包含一个主题。学习必备欢迎下载()7.数据表中的数据项称为记录,记录表示物体某方面的属性。()8.字符型也能比较大小,一般根据字符的编码进行。()9. 语句“ SELECT * COUNT(* ) AS 总人数 FROM学生成绩”语法是正确的。()10. 语句“ SELECT MAX(语文), MIN(数学) FROM学生成绩”结果显示出错。四、简单题

10、(共50 分)1. 什么是数据库?( 5 分)2. 写出 DB, DBMS, DBS的中文含义。(6 分)3.数据库技术中数据模型的发展主要经历了哪几种?(5 分)学习必备欢迎下载4. 数据表设计过程中应遵循哪几个原则?( 4 分)5. 写出下列 SQL语句的功能( 12 分)(1)SELECT 学号,姓名,语文,数学,英语FROM成绩(2)SELECT * FROM成绩(3)SELECT * FROM学生 WHERE 姓名 LIKE “李向 * ”(4)SELECT * FROM档案 WHERE 出生日期 =#8/15/1996#(5)SELECT COUNT(*) AS总人数FROM学生(

11、6)SELECT * FROM成绩 ORDER BY语文 DESC学习必备欢迎下载6. 设有如下结构的某商店的数据管理系统数据表“进货单” ,写出实现以下要求的 SQL语句( 18 分):货号货物名称单价数量入库时间是否打折100121花瓶121502010-12-25True100122电热水壶25202010-10-2False100123水果盘10152010-12-22False100124方巾2702010-20-22True100125浴巾15202010-11-13False注:“货号”为字符型, “货物名称”字符型, “单价”数值型, “入库时间”日期型,“是否打折”逻辑型。(

12、 1)显示“进货单”中所有的货物名称和单价信息:货物名称单价花瓶12电热水壶25水果盘10方巾2浴巾15( 2)显示下表所示的进货信息货号货物名称总金额入库时间是否打折100121花瓶19502010-12-25True100122电热水壶5002010-10-2False100123水果盘1502010-12-22False100124方巾1402010-20-22True100125浴巾3002010-11-13False注:总金额 =单价 * 数量学习必备欢迎下载( 3)显示 12 月份的进货信息:货号货物名称入库时间100121花瓶2010-12-25100123水果盘2010-12-22( 4)统计 20XX年 10 月 30 日以来进货的物品种类数量:物品总类数量3( 5)显示所有没有折扣货物信息:货号货物名称单价数量入库时间是否打折100122电热水壶25202010-10-2False100123水果盘10152010-12-22False100125浴巾15202010-11-13False( 6)对所有物品按入库时间降序排序,入库时间相同,按货号升序排:货号货物名称单价数量入库

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论